Maintaining compliance with regulatory standards is crucial for the smooth and efficient operation of any fleet. Non-compliance can lead to severe consequences that affect not only the operational efficiency but also the financial stability and reputation of a fleet company. Understanding the impact of non-compliance and implementing proactive measures to avoid it is essential for fleet managers. Here’s an in-depth look at the repercussions of non-compliance and strategies to ensure continuous fleet compliance.

Consequences of Non-Compliance

Financial Penalties

Non-compliance with regulatory standards can result in substantial fines and penalties. These financial repercussions can strain a fleet’s budget and affect overall profitability. Regular audits and inspections by regulatory authorities can uncover compliance violations, leading to immediate and hefty fines.

Operational Disruptions

Non-compliance issues can cause significant operational disruptions. For example, failure to maintain proper driver qualification files or adhere to hours-of-service (HOS) regulations can lead to driver disqualifications and vehicle out-of-service orders. This disrupts schedules, delays deliveries, and impacts customer satisfaction.

Legal Liabilities

Non-compliance can expose fleet companies to legal liabilities, including lawsuits and litigation. Accidents or incidents resulting from non-compliance with safety regulations can lead to costly legal battles and settlements. This not only drains financial resources but also tarnishes the company’s reputation.

Increased Insurance Costs

Insurance companies often view non-compliance as a risk factor, leading to increased insurance premiums. Repeated violations and non-compliance issues can result in higher insurance costs, further straining the fleet’s financial resources.

Damage to Reputation

Non-compliance can severely damage a fleet company’s reputation. Regulatory violations and safety incidents can lead to negative publicity and erode trust among customers, partners, and stakeholders. A damaged reputation can result in loss of business and long-term financial harm.

Proactive Measures to Ensure Compliance

Implement Robust Compliance Management Systems

Invest in comprehensive compliance management systems that automate and streamline compliance processes. These systems can help maintain accurate records, provide real-time updates on regulatory changes, and generate alerts for upcoming compliance deadlines.

Regular Training and Education

Provide ongoing training and education for drivers and staff on regulatory requirements and best practices. Ensure that everyone is aware of the latest regulations and understands the importance of compliance. Regular refresher courses can help reinforce compliance standards.

Conduct Internal Audits

Perform regular internal audits to assess compliance status and identify potential issues before they escalate. Internal audits can help ensure that all records are up-to-date, procedures are followed, and compliance gaps are addressed promptly.

Leverage Technology for Monitoring and Reporting

Utilize technology to monitor compliance in real-time and generate comprehensive reports. Telematics systems, electronic logging devices (ELDs), and other monitoring tools can provide valuable data on driver behavior, vehicle performance, and compliance status.

Establish Clear Policies and Procedures

Develop clear policies and procedures that outline compliance requirements and expectations. Ensure that all employees understand and adhere to these policies. Regularly review and update policies to reflect changes in regulations and industry standards.
